Last year an excellent Discovery documentary called: “Bigfoot The Definitive Guide” provided a global perspective to scientific research about the possible origins of the large omnivorous ape.  The team of researchers, including Dr. Jeffrey Meldrum and Ian Redmond, pointed to a prehistoric ape, Gigantopithecus that last lived 300,000 years ago in Central China.  The yeti of the Himalayan region and the mande barung of Northern India closely match the descriptions of the mysterious creature that is frequently sighted in the rainforest of the Pacific Northwest.  It was speculated that some prehistoric apes could have migrated when the land bridge from Asia to North America existed.  Another view was that the Bigfoot could be the result of evolutionary branching from the prehistoric species, Neanderthal.  The Homo heidelbergensis was still alive when the first humans crossed the land bridge 12,000 years ago.  It was noted that no piece of evidence, such as a finger bone, has ever been discovered that would substantiate the existence of the modern day creature, although a large number of credible sightings have been documented in the Northwest, especially on Vancouver Island, fittingly dubbed ‘Ape Island’.
